Understanding Your Needs
Before diving into the selection process, assess your specific lighting needs. Are you looking for residential, commercial, or industrial lighting solutions? Define your requirements regarding brightness, energy efficiency, and intended usage. For instance, offices may need warm lighting for comfort, while warehouses might require bright, cold light for visibility.

Quality and Standards Compliance
Verify that the manufacturer adheres to industry standards, such as ISO 9001 certification and compliance with the Department of Energy (DOE) guidelines. A manufacturer that meets these standards ensures product quality and efficiency. According to a study by the U.S. Department of Energy, compliant products can save customers up to 75% on energy costs compared to traditional lighting.

Technical Support and Warranty
Consider the level of technical support the manufacturer provides post-purchase. Reliable manufacturers often offer warranties ranging from 3 to 10 years, covering defects and performance issues. A solid warranty can be a game-changer in protecting your investment and ensuring peace of mind.
Pricing and Transparency
While price shouldn't be the sole deciding factor, it’s essential to compare costs transparently. Request quotes from multiple manufacturers, but also analyze what's included. Cheaper options might compromise quality, leading to higher long-term costs. A comprehensive cost analysis can help avoid potential financial pitfalls.
